免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

app开发丨定制好还是模板好

在进行app开发时,很多人都面临一个选择:是定制开发还是使用现有的模板?这是一个非常重要的决策,因为它直接影响到你的app的质量、功能和用户体验。在本文中,我将详细介绍定制开发和模板开发的原理和优缺点,帮助你做出明智的选择。

首先,让我们来了解一下定制开发。定制开发是指根据特定需求从头开始开发一个全新的app。这种方法的最大优势是灵活性。你可以根据你的需求和想法来设计和开发每一个功能和界面。这意味着你可以完全掌控你的app的外观和功能,以及如何与用户进行交互。此外,定制开发还可以为你提供更好的性能和安全性,因为你可以根据最佳实践和最新技术来构建你的app。

然而,定制开发也有一些缺点。首先,它需要更多的时间和资源。由于你需要从零开始构建整个app,这意味着你需要投入更多的时间和精力来完成开发工作。此外,定制开发通常需要更高的技术水平。如果你没有足够的开发经验或技能,可能会遇到一些困难和挑战。最后,定制开发的成本通常更高。由于需要更多的工作量和技术投入,定制开发的费用可能会比使用模板高出很多。

接下来,让我们来看看模板开发。模板开发是指使用现有的app模板来构建你的app。这种方法的最大优势是快速和简单。你可以选择一个适合你需求的模板,然后根据你的品牌和需求进行一些定制。这样可以节省大量的开发时间和资源,让你更快地推出你的app。此外,模板开发通常更适合那些没有很高的技术水平或经验的人。模板通常提供了一些简单易用的工具和界面,使你可以轻松地进行一些定制和修改。

然而,模板开发也有一些限制。首先,你的app可能会与其他使用相同模板的app相似。因为模板是公开的,其他人也可以使用相同的模板来构建他们的app。这意味着你的app可能会失去独特性和个性化。此外,模板通常有一些限制和局限性,你可能无法满足所有的需求和想法。最后,模板开发可能会受到模板提供者的限制。如果模板提供者停止更新或关闭了他们的服务,你可能会面临一些问题和挑战。

综上所述,定制开发和模板开发都有各自的优缺点。选择哪种方法取决于你的需求、预算和技术水平。如果你有足够的时间、资源和技术能力,并且想要一个独特和个性化的app,那么定制开发是一个不错的选择。然而,如果你希望快速推出一个简单的app,并且对个性化和独特性没有很高的要求,那么模板开发可能更适合你。无论你选择哪种方法,都要记住在开发过程中注重用户体验和功能的质量,这样才能确保你的app能够成功。


相关知识:
如何快速开发买菜app
在当今社会,越来越多的人选择在网上购买日常生活用品,其中包括食材。开发一款买菜app,能够为消费者提供便利的同时,也是一个商业机会。下面,将介绍如何快速开发买菜app。一、确定需求在开始开发前,首先需要明确买菜app的需求。这包括用户登录、浏览商品、下单、
2024-01-10
如何开发电子词典app
电子词典app是一款非常实用的工具软件,可以帮助用户快速查询单词的解释、音标、例句等信息。本文将介绍电子词典app的开发原理和详细步骤。1. 确定需求在开发电子词典app之前,我们需要先确定用户的需求。一般来说,电子词典app的主要功能包括:查询单词、收藏
2024-01-10
app框架开发哪家好
在选择app框架开发的时候,有很多优秀的选择。下面我将介绍几个比较流行的app框架,包括它们的原理和详细介绍。1. React NativeReact Native是由Facebook开发的一款跨平台移动应用开发框架。它使用JavaScript语言进行开发
2023-06-29
app开发中插入和删除行
在app开发中,插入和删除行是常见的操作之一。这些操作通常用于处理列表或表格中的数据,例如在一个To-Do List应用中添加或删除任务。下面将详细介绍插入和删除行的原理和具体实现方式。1. 插入行的原理和实现方式:插入行的原理是在列表或表格中添加一行新的
2023-06-29
app和网页开发哪个简单
App和网页开发各有优势和难点,因此无法直接比较哪个更简单。但是根据项目需求、个人技能和时间限制等不同情况下,确定使用何种开发方式将更加切实可行。App开发通常涉及iOS(苹果)和Android(谷歌)两个平台,需要开发者掌握不同的语言和技术。例如,iOS
2023-05-06
appcan开发使用jpush
Appcan是一个专注于移动应用程序开发的全方位解决方案供应商。JPush是一款专门针对移动应用推送的云服务。结合使用可以实现推送功能,以下是关于使用JPush在Appcan中开发应用时的原理和详细介绍。一、JPush的原理JPush是极光推送推出的服务之
2023-05-06